MattyB
Member
- Thread starter
- #1
So I'm a new jeep owner and got bit as they say. I'm about to start the build. On the list is a hydro assist. My question is, does the steering stabilizer get eliminated, or do they cohabitate? They seem to be pretty close in location if I put the ram where I see it most commonly installed. Forgive the ignorance. Thanks in advance.
Sponsored